Cours virtualisation et cloud pdf

Institut Supérieur des Études Technologiques ISET de Kairouan Ce cours s ? adresse à tous les étudiants en informatique Cours Virtualisation et Cloud Noureddine GRASSA Kairouan le août CTable des matières La Virtualisation Introduction Les hyperviseurs hyperviseur de type hyperviseur de type Les di ?érents types de la Virtualisation Virtualisation Complète Para-Virtualisation Les Isolateurs Les principales solutions XEN KVM VMware ESX Hyper-V OpenVZ LXC Domaines d ? application La Virtualisation de Stockage Stockage en Réseau Conclusion Cloud Computing Dé ?nition Les di ?érents types du Cloud SAAS Software as a Service PAAS Plateform as a Service IAAS Infrastructure as a Service Les architectures Cloud Le Cloud Privé Le Cloud Public Le Cloud Hybride C Avantages et Béné ?ces Les di ?érents acteurs du Cloud Amazon SalesForce Microsoft Google OpenStack Conclusion Bibliographie CChapitre La Virtualisation Introduction Un serveur est un ordinateur utilisé à distance depuis di ?érents postes de travail ou autres serveurs Il possède des ressources matérielles principalement CPU mémoire disques et interfaces réseau Ces ressources sont utilisées par des applications non pas de manière directe mais en s ? appuyant sur un système d ? exploitation La virtualisation de serveurs est un ensemble de techniques et d ? outils permettant de faire tourner plusieurs systèmes d ? exploitation sur un même serveur physique Le principe de la virtualisation est donc un principe de partage les di ?érents systèmes d ? exploitation se partagent les ressources du serveur Pour être utile de manière opérationnelle la virtualisation doit respecter deux principes fondamentaux Le cloisonnement chaque système d ? exploitation a un fonctionnement indépendant et ne peut interférer avec les autres en aucune manière La transparence le fait de fonctionner en mode virtualisé ne change rien au fonctionnement du système d ? exploitation et a fortiori des applications La transparence implique la compatibilité toutes les applications peuvent tourner sur un système virtualisé et leur fonctionnement n ?est en rien modi ?é CFigure ?? Architecture Virtualisée Les hyperviseurs Un hyperviseur est une plate-forme de virtualisation qui permet à plusieurs systèmes d ? exploitation de travailler sur une même machine physique en même temps hyperviseur de type Un hyperviseur de Type ou natif voire bare metal littéralement métal nu est un logiciel qui s ? exécute directement sur une plateforme matérielle cette plateforme est alors considérée comme outil de contrôle de système d ? exploitation Un système d ? exploitation secondaire peut de ce fait être exécuté au-dessus du matériel L ? hyperviseur type est un noyau hôte allégé et optimisé pour ne faire tourner initialement que des noyaux de systèmes d ? exploitation invités adaptés et optimisés à cette architecture spéci ?que ces systèmes invités ayant conscience d ? être virtualisés Sur des processeurs ayant les instructions de virtualisation matérielle AMD-V et Intel VT le système d ? exploitation invité n ? a plus besoin d ? être modi ?é pour pouvoir être exécuté dans un hyperviseur de type Quelques exemples de tels hyperviseurs plus récents sont Xen Oracle VM ESX Server de

  • 31
  • 0
  • 0
Afficher les détails des licences
Licence et utilisation
Gratuit pour un usage personnel Aucune attribution requise
Partager